Achievement IQ – The Definition

by Stanley Bronstein on February 5, 2008

Achievement IQ and the Laws of Positioning
a • chieve • ment iq n – A measure of a person’s or an organization’s ability to

  • recognize details and opportunities most others do not see, thus putting themselves IN A POSITION of readiness;
  • put themselves IN A POSITION to attract opportunities;
  • POSITION THEMSELVES to be ready to take advantage of these opportunities once they do come their way; and
  • then take action upon these opportunities in a manner that most others would not, thus putting themselves IN A POSITION to be more successful than most
